#include <hurd.h> | |
#include <hurd/fd.h> | |
#include <hurd/resource.h> | |
#include <stdlib.h> | |
#include "hurdmalloc.h" /* XXX */ | |
/* Allocate a new file descriptor and return it, locked. The new | |
descriptor number will be no less than FIRST_FD. If the table is full, | |
set errno to EMFILE and return NULL. If FIRST_FD is negative or bigger | |
than the size of the table, set errno to EINVAL and return NULL. */ | |
struct hurd_fd * | |
_hurd_alloc_fd (int *fd, int first_fd) | |
{ | |
int i; | |
void *crit; | |
long int rlimit; | |
if (first_fd < 0) | |
{ | |
errno = EINVAL; | |
return NULL; | |
} | |
crit = _hurd_critical_section_lock (); | |
__mutex_lock (&_hurd_dtable_lock); | |
search: | |
for (i = first_fd; i < _hurd_dtablesize; ++i) | |
{ | |
struct hurd_fd *d = _hurd_dtable[i]; | |
if (d == NULL) | |
{ | |
/* Allocate a new descriptor structure for this slot, | |
initializing its port cells to nil. The test below will catch | |
and return this descriptor cell after locking it. */ | |
d = _hurd_new_fd (MACH_PORT_NULL, MACH_PORT_NULL); | |
if (d == NULL) | |
{ | |
__mutex_unlock (&_hurd_dtable_lock); | |
_hurd_critical_section_unlock (crit); | |
return NULL; | |
} | |
_hurd_dtable[i] = d; | |
} | |
__spin_lock (&d->port.lock); | |
if (d->port.port == MACH_PORT_NULL) | |
{ | |
__mutex_unlock (&_hurd_dtable_lock); | |
_hurd_critical_section_unlock (crit); | |
if (fd != NULL) | |
*fd = i; | |
return d; | |
} | |
else | |
__spin_unlock (&d->port.lock); | |
} | |
__mutex_lock (&_hurd_rlimit_lock); | |
rlimit = _hurd_rlimits[RLIMIT_OFILE].rlim_cur; | |
__mutex_unlock (&_hurd_rlimit_lock); | |
if (first_fd < rlimit) | |
{ | |
/* The descriptor table is full. Check if we have reached the | |
resource limit, or only the allocated size. */ | |
if (_hurd_dtablesize < rlimit) | |
{ | |
/* Enlarge the table. */ | |
int save = errno; | |
struct hurd_fd **new; | |
/* Try to double the table size, but don't exceed the limit, | |
and make sure it exceeds FIRST_FD. */ | |
int size = _hurd_dtablesize * 2; | |
if (size > rlimit) | |
size = rlimit; | |
else if (size <= first_fd) | |
size = first_fd + 1; | |
if (size * sizeof (*_hurd_dtable) < size) | |
{ | |
/* Integer overflow! */ | |
errno = ENOMEM; | |
goto out; | |
} | |
/* If we fail to allocate that, decrement the desired size | |
until we succeed in allocating it. */ | |
do | |
new = realloc (_hurd_dtable, size * sizeof (*_hurd_dtable)); | |
while (new == NULL && size-- > first_fd); | |
if (new != NULL) | |
{ | |
/* We managed to allocate a new table. Now install it. */ | |
errno = save; | |
if (first_fd < _hurd_dtablesize) | |
first_fd = _hurd_dtablesize; | |
/* Initialize the new slots. */ | |
for (i = _hurd_dtablesize; i < size; ++i) | |
new[i] = NULL; | |
_hurd_dtablesize = size; | |
_hurd_dtable = new; | |
/* Go back to the loop to initialize the first new slot. */ | |
goto search; | |
} | |
else | |
errno = ENOMEM; | |
} | |
else | |
errno = EMFILE; | |
} | |
else | |
errno = EINVAL; /* Bogus FIRST_FD value. */ | |
out: | |
__mutex_unlock (&_hurd_dtable_lock); | |
_hurd_critical_section_unlock (crit); | |
return NULL; | |
} |
